✦ Synopsis


The physico-chemical properties of carbon-supported Cu catalysts used for producing dimethyl carbonate were investigated. The specific surface area decreases with increase in the thermal treatment temperature and the Cu content of the catalyst. The molar ratios of OH/Cu also have effect on the specific surface area of the catalysts and their activity. An uniform dispersion of the Cu component and a proper Cu content and molar ratio of OH/Cu are required in order to obtain a high conversion of methanol and high selectivity to DMC.
